⑧【MySQL】数据库查询:内连接、外连接、自连接、子查询、多表查询

`多表关系`:- **一对一** :在`任意一方`加入外键,关联另一方的主键,并设置外键为唯一(UNIQUE)。- **一对多(多对一)** :在`多`的一方建立外键,指向`一`的一方的主键。- **多对多** :建立第三张表作为中间表,中间表**至少包含两个外键,分别关联双方主键**。**笛卡尔积

操作MySQL实现简单的创建库和创建表

数据库的基本操作,简单易懂、清晰明了.

基于mybatis进行批量更新

MyBatis是一种基于Java的持久层框架,提供了一种优雅的方式来进行数据库操作。对于批量更新数据操作,MyBatis 提供了两种方法:使用 foreach 标签和 batch 执行器。需要注意的是,使用 batch 执行器执行批量操作时需要关闭二级缓存,否则会造成更新操作失败。使用 foreac

MYSQL字符串函数详解和实战(字符串函数大全,内含示例)

MySQL四十八个数字符串函数一万八千多字总结(你要的全部都有)对字符串进行各种操作。。建议收藏以备后续用到查阅参考。

Java+SSM+MySQL基于微信小程序的商城购物小程序(附源码 调试 文档)

本文介绍了一种基于微信小程序的商城购物小程序,该系统分为管理员和用户两种用户角色。管理员可以通过系统进行资讯管理、用户管理、分类管理、商品管理、订单管理、评价管理和系统管理。用户则可以通过系统进行授权登录、资讯查看、商品搜索、分类筛选、商品详细查看、在线下单、购物车管理和我的订单管理等操作。本系统的

MySQL---表的增查改删(CRUD进阶)

全网最详细的MySQL查询介绍---没有之一!

MySQL库的操作『增删改查 ‖ 编码问题 ‖ 备份与恢复』

不行,会直接报错的,既然校验规则不适用,创建了也没意义,这就好比你往语文卷子上写英语,语文老师大概率是看不懂的,并且不会批改你的卷子。中,会出现各种奇怪的问题,毕竟老版本没有新特性,还有就是这种做法太暴力了。,如果用户不指定,就使用默认的,如果用户指定了,就优先使用用户指定的。是用来存放内容的,内容

Android Termux安装MySQL,通过内网穿透实现公网远程访问

Android作为移动设备,尽管最初并非设计为服务器,但是随着技术的进步我们可以将Android配置为生产力工具,变成一个随身Linux。MariaDB是MySQL关系数据库管理系统的一个复刻,由社区开发,有商业支持,旨在继续保持在 GNU GPL 下开源。开发这个分支的原因之一是:甲骨文公司收购了

【MySQL】事务(中)

说明 任何一个人 不一定 要看到 最新的世界,也不一定 要 看到比较老的世界,只要看到在自己生命周期之内的事情即可。事务1 将表的数据删除 或 提交,事务2 都是看不到的表的变化 ,直到事务2也提交,才可以看到表的变化。所有事务都要有执行过程 ,那么在 多个事务 各自执行多个SQL的时候,就有有

MySQL 8.0.35数据库的下载安装以及环境变量的配置

记录数据库的下载安装方法,供初学者学习。

[MySQL] MySQL中的数据类型

在MySQL中,数据类型用于定义表中列的数据的类型。在前面的几篇文章中,我们也会看到有很多的数据类型,例如:char、varchar、date、int等等。本篇文章会对常见的数据类型进行详细讲解。超级详细结合实例,希望会对你有所帮助。具体如下图:我们再来插入一些数据,具体如下图:通过上图可以看到,再

如何下载 Apache + PHP + Mysql 集成安装环境并结合内网穿透工具实现公网访问内网服务

本文主要讲解如何安装WampServer并结合内网穿透工具实现公网访问内网服务。

MySQL 数据库 binLog 日志的使用

MySQL 数据库 binLog 日志的使用

[Java Web]JDBC->Java操作MySQL数据库

JDBC->超一万字文章带你详细了解Java操作MySQL数据库的各种步骤,后续会更新一篇关于JDBC综合实践案例说明文章,敬请期待。

Spark 增量抽取 Mysql To Hive

【代码】Spark 增量抽取 Mysql To Hive。

mysql 中将汉字(中文)按照拼音首字母排序、数字和英文排序

因为数据库中可以设定表的编码格式,不同编码格式下,中文的排序有区别,下面分别介绍常用编码下的排序方法。直接排序就行,因为 GBK 编码本来就是排序汉字首字母进行排序的。order by birary(表别名.字段名) asc;order by 表别名.字段名asc;

Linux上运行MySQL出现“ERROR 2002 (HY000): Can't connect to

在Linux上运行MySQL时,可能会遇到“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)”的错误。该错误通常意味着客户端无法通过套接字连

MySQL:语法速查手册【持续更新...】

记录MySQL中的基础语法知识,方便需要时查询

MySQL中插入字段时怎么设置字段值是默认值?

插入字段设置为默认值:1、不指定该字段的值:在插入语句中,不包含该字段及其对应的值。数据库将会自动使用该字段的默认值。综上,要想插入的字段设置为默认值:1.插入字段不指定该字段 2.用default关键字。关键字来指定使用字段的默认值。字段将会被自动设置为默认值。2、使用默认关键字:使用。字段也会

MySQL表的增删改查(进阶)

引入约束的规则,是为了更强的数据检查/校验.数据一定要保证正确性.(如果后续插入/修改的数据不符合要求,就会报错)执行效率(代码在机器上跑的快不快)

登录可以使用的更多功能哦! 登录
作者榜
...
资讯小助手

资讯同步

...
内容小助手

文章同步

...
Deephub

公众号:deephub-imba

...
奕凯

公众号:奕凯的技术栈